About PRISM

PRISM is an advanced AI-powered platform designed to help businesses extract actionable insights from vast amounts of unstructured customer data. It leverages sophisticated Natural Language Processing (NLP) and Machine Learning (ML) algorithms to analyze diverse data sources such as CRM notes, support tickets, social media conversations, customer reviews, survey responses, and call transcripts. The platform's core capability lies in its ability to identify patterns, sentiments, emerging trends, and key themes that might otherwise remain hidden within qualitative data. This allows organizations to gain a deeper, more nuanced understanding of customer needs, preferences, pain points, and overall sentiment.

Key features include automated data ingestion from multiple sources, real-time sentiment analysis, topic modeling, trend detection, and customizable dashboards for visualization. PRISM helps businesses move beyond superficial metrics to uncover the "why" behind customer behavior. Its capabilities extend to predicting future customer needs, identifying product improvement opportunities, and personalizing customer experiences at scale.

The primary use cases for PRISM span across various departments. Product teams can utilize it for feature prioritization and roadmap planning based on direct customer feedback. Marketing teams can refine messaging, identify market opportunities, and understand brand perception. Customer success and support teams can proactively address issues, improve service quality, and reduce churn by understanding common problems and sentiments. Business leaders can make data-driven strategic decisions by having a holistic view of their customer base. The target audience includes enterprises and growing businesses across industries that are looking to transform their unstructured customer data into a strategic asset for growth and competitive advantage.
